Feng Shui: The ritual of placing money under the doormat for prosperity
According to Feng Shui principles, a practice that lacks scientific backing, placing a banknote beneath the entrance doormat or rug is proposed as a symbolic gesture. This ritual is intended to invite prosperity and new opportunities into one's home. The practice is rooted in the belief that this action can attract positive energy and financial abundance.
This Feng Shui practice, while symbolic, operates outside empirical validation. Its efficacy relies entirely on belief systems and the psychological impact of performing a ritual intended to attract wealth. From a systems perspective, such practices may offer a sense of agency and optimism, potentially influencing an individual's mindset towards seeking opportunities. However, attributing financial success solely to this ritual overlooks the complex interplay of economic factors, personal effort, and systemic structures that genuinely drive prosperity. The practice highlights a human desire for control over financial outcomes, often sought through symbolic actions when tangible solutions appear elusive.
